Output 299e58f752178f7504aa075489294552c7cec7565d2ba3bede43d6ce34bc5d4b:6

value
11592274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f674c965e59c62c1686af1b0ada5c87077614ae OP_EQUAL
address
MRMD3RRb1Nw34p1vQsCbu7Ag141SjAKx8y
transaction
299e58f752178f7504aa075489294552c7cec7565d2ba3bede43d6ce34bc5d4b
spent
true